Abstract

A numerical method is described for the conformal mapping of simply connected domains whose boundaries contains sharp corner points. The method is based on a first kind integral equation formulation due to Wendland [15]. On each component analytic arc of the boundary, the dominant singularities of the unknown source density ν are incorporated in a Jacobi weight function w, so that ν/ w may be approximated by a finite Jacobi polynomial series. The coefficients in these series are determined by collocation. Numerical example illustrate the accuracy of the proposed technique.
